Fourth Wapiti this weekend

Fernie’s Annex Park will come to life this weekend when the Wapiti Music Festival takes place (August 8-9).

The festival is featuring a host of Canadian indie talent including: July Talk, Zeus, The Strumbellas, Good for Grapes, Fast Romantics, JP Hoe, Greg Drummond, Jordan Klassen and more.

Storming the indie scene, July Talk’s true rock and roll sound will take the CBC Stage Saturday night, sharing the evening with Fast Romantics and The Strumbellas.

The Strumbella’s (pictured above) recently took home the 2014 Juno Award for Roots Album of the Year. Toronto’s Zeus and Vancouver’s Good for Grapes is a must see for the Friday night lineup. Listen and explore the full lineup on the Wapiti website.

Heading into its fourth year, Wapiti Music Festival brings the best of ‘Fresh Canadian Indie’ right into Fernie’s backyard for two days of awesome fun for all ages.

New this year is a free community outdoor concert on Thursday evening, August 7 at The Arts Station in downtown Fernie, featuring Victoria B.C.’s Wil.

This will be a free show to the public Thursday evening to kick off the Wapiti weekend.

Kids 12 and under and seniors 65 and older are free.

There will once again be a kids’ tent, refreshment gardens and a vendor village to take care of all your needs.
